Van Province, Administrative province in Eastern Anatolia, Turkey

This first-level division sits in eastern Anatolia between a large highland lake and the Iranian border. It contains thirteen administrative districts spread across rolling terrain marked by mountains and broad plains.

This territory formed the heart of the kingdom of Urartu in the 9th century BC. It later became part of the Ottoman realm and was organized as a modern Turkish administrative unit in 1926.

The name comes from the Urartian language and recalls an ancient royal city once located here. Markets today echo mainly with Kurdish speech, while teahouses and bakeries serve local treats such as herby white cheese enjoyed at breakfast.

An airport with daily connections sits northwest of the capital city and links the area to other Turkish cities. Travelers using coaches should allow extra hours for mountain roads, especially during winter months.

The Turkish highland lake reaches a depth of 170 meters (558 feet) and remains ice-free even in winter due to its high salt content. The cat breed named after this region often shows two different eye colors.
